个人介绍
一、Java部分
熟悉java编程规范,熟悉java面向对象分析与设计。
熟悉java基础知识以及核心类库。熟练运用反射、io、nio、多线程、socket等相关知识进行软件开发。
熟悉j2ee开发相关框架与技能。
熟悉oracle,mysql等关系型数据库,能都做到简单的sql优化。
熟悉svn,vss、git等版本控制软件的使用。了解ant、maven等项目构件工具。
熟悉java poi对office进行相关的操作,熟悉java调用ftp,sftp的相关接口进行文件的上传下载
熟悉MVC开发模式,能熟练运用、Spring、SpringMVC、Mybatis等框架的整合开发;
熟练掌握javaWeb技术,包括jsp、Servlet、Filter、Listener、Cookie、Session、EL表达式、JSTL等技术
熟练掌握JavaScript编程、Jquery框架以及Ajax前台技术、熟悉json数据与后台之间的交互、熟练使用bootstrap、easyui框架
熟练运用Oracle、Mysql等数据库开发,SQL性能优化;
熟悉weblogic或tomcat等中间件;
熟悉SOA面向服务式架构
熟悉solr全文搜索技术
熟悉dubbo分布式、高性能、透明化的RPC服务框架、zookeeper注册中心的搭建
熟练运用Eclipse、Git、Maven、SVN等开发及项目管理工具;
了解Nginx、solr集群、zookeeper集群、Redis集群、ActiveMQ、FreeMarker等技术
了解linux系统以及常用命令、以及连接工具SecureCRT ,winscp
二、大数据部分
1、了解hdfs、mapreduce、yarn等hadoop生态体系相关技术。能独立完成集群环境的部署以及mapreduce程序的开发。
2、了解zookeeper分布式协调服务的使用。
3、了解Hbase数据库,熟练使用客户端进行数据操作。了解Hive的使用,熟练使用hql进行数据分析。能够使用sqoop进行关系型数据库与hdfs/hive之间进行数据导入导出。了解flume+kafka+storm流式计算相关框架技术。
工作经历
2015-06-02 -至今上海舞泡网络科技高级后端工程师
技术部担任java软件开发工程师,项目组长
2014-07-01 -2015-05-01北京网梯科技高级后端工程师
北京网梯科技有限公司担任java软件开发工程师,从事技 术开发、测试、维护等。
教育经历
2009-09-01 - 2013-09-07河北科技大学软件工程本科
熟悉软件开发流程与管理。
技能
创新商城电子商务平台,面对的买家用户为科研院所、高校、研发型企业、医疗机构等从事科研的用户,满足其科研用品采购、科研经费及采购管理、科研资讯交流、资金增值的平台;面对的卖家用户为科研用品的生产商、代理或经销商,满足其商品销售(包括跨境销售)、线上促销、新品推广、贸易融资(订单贷、应收贷等)等需求。集交易平台+管理平台+学术交流平台+资金管理平台为一体。 它的系统主要包括『前台商城系统』、『后台管理系统』,及一些『周边系统』。 [商城会员]可以在『前台商城系统』搜索商品、用户登录、添加购物车、提交订单等操作。 [商城运营人员]可以在『后台管理系统』中管理商品、订单、会员等信息。 [商城客服人员]可以在『后台管理系统』中处理用户的询问以及投诉等操作。
使用flume读取系统后台日志,通过kafka将flume读取的日志传递到storm进行分析处理,过滤出异常信息,将异常信息处理,发送给相应的开发人员 分析舞泡系统的后台日志,如果有异常会通过邮件或者短信的方式通知相应的开发人员进行维护